One for the Boys



Good morning to you all, it's time for our new challenge at Allsorts and Kevin has chosen the theme of  'One for the Boys'. Our sponsor is Crafty Ribbons.


My card is one of a collection made a few weeks back for Tattered Lace promotional material using the lovely sailing ship and compass from the Men's Collection. I created a background by inking an acrylic block with grid lines and distress inks fossilised amber, cracked pistachio and faded jeans........I know this is my no means a new technique but for those of you new to it, ink the block with one colour at a time, spritz with water and stamp, cleaning the block between each colour and over stamping to achieve the pattern size that fits with your card.

I used the same process to colour a scrap of card using just the fossilised amber and used that to cut the anchor and sails a second time to decoupage. The sentiment is computer generated.
